TelMed (CallMed) or TelMed (Compact One) — Basel-Stadt

Basel-Stadt: with Sanitas, TelMed (CallMed) costs CHF 654.70 a month in 2026 and TelMed (Compact One) CHF 598.40, for an adult with a CHF 300 deductible and accident cover. The table below gives the gap at every deductible.

TelMed (Compact One) is the cheaper of the two here: CHF 675.60 saved per year against TelMed (CallMed), for cover identical under the law. What you pay more or less for is the care pathway.
